
May 29th was a very sad event at the Orangeburg Drag Strip in South Carolina. Dean Martin racing his ChevyII flipped and was not wearing proper saftey gear and was killed. But the truely real tragedy was his young Grandson was the only one there with him. The other part of the Tragedy was there was no Ambulance on site. It took over 30 minutes for a Ambulance to arrive to the scene.
This is not the first incident where no Ambulance was on scene. This track is rated IHRA sanction.
If the racers would refuse to go back until the owners take responsabilty and have a Ambulance on the scene at every race this will not be the last Tragedy at this track. Boycott is the only way to get this changed. It is so un fair to the Racers and there Family & Friends that the Track will not always spend the money to have a Ambulance on site.
I suggest that the IHRA investigate this Track, for saftey issues.They do not even check the saftey equipment in these racers cars.
